解密区块链双签应用,提升安全与效率的关键技术

在区块链技术飞速发展的今天,安全性、效率和去中心化程度的平衡一直是行业探索的核心议题。“双签”(Dual Signature)作为一种重要的技术应用,正逐渐受到广泛关注,究竟什么是区块链双签应用?它又为区块链世界带来了哪些改变呢?

什么是区块链双签?

要理解“双签应用”,首先需要明白“双签”的基本概念,在区块链中,“签名”(Signature)通常指的是使用私钥对交易数据进行加密认证的过程,用于证明交易发起者的身份并确保交易数据的不可篡改,而“双签”,顾名思义,就是指一笔交易或某个关键操作需要两个不同的签名才能被成功执行和确认。

这里的“两个不同签名”可以有多种理解形式,最常见的包括:

  1. 多方共同控制:一个由多方共同管理的钱包或智能合约,发起交易时需要获得其中两个(或多个)指定私钥持有者的签名授权,交易才能被广播上链,这类似于现实中“双人复核”的机制。
  2. 用户与平台双重验证:在某些应用场景中,用户自身的签名是第一层验证,同时还需要平台方或某个可信第三方的第二层签名,交易才能生效,这既保障了用户权益,也便于平台进行合规管理。
  3. 跨链或跨协议交互
    随机配图
    中的双重确认
    :在涉及不同区块链网络或协议交互的场景中,可能需要源链和目标链(或相关协议)的双重签名确认,以确保资产或信息传递的准确性和安全性。

简而言之,双签机制通过引入第二重签名验证,显著提高了交易或操作的门槛和安全性,有效防止了单点故障或单方恶意行为带来的风险。

区块链双签应用的核心价值

双签应用并非区块链的“原生”概念,但它巧妙地嫁接到了区块链的信任机制之上,带来了诸多核心价值:

  1. 增强安全性,防范单点风险:这是双签最核心的价值,单私钥模式一旦私钥泄露或丢失,资产将面临巨大风险,双签机制则要求攻击者同时获取两个(或多个)独立的私钥才能非法交易,这几乎是不可能完成的任务,从而极大地提升了资产安全性。
  2. 实现多方协作与共同控制:在组织、基金、家族资产管理等场景下,双签(或多签)机制可以实现“共同控制”,一个组织的资金动用需要两位负责人的共同授权,避免了单一负责人滥用权力或失误带来的损失,体现了民主决策和风险共担。
  3. 提升合规性与可追溯性:在某些受监管的金融或商业场景中,双签可以引入监管方或审计方的第二重签名,这不仅有助于满足合规要求,使得每一笔可追溯的交易都有据可查,也能增强合作伙伴间的信任。
  4. 优化用户体验,平衡去中心化与效率:虽然双签增加了验证步骤,但在某些场景下,它可以通过预设规则(如任意两个指定签名即可)来简化流程,同时相比完全中心化的控制,它保留了区块链的去中心化特性,是一种安全与效率的平衡。

区块链双签的典型应用场景

双签机制在多个领域都有着广阔的应用前景:

  • 多签名钱包(Multisig Wallets):这是双签最常见的应用形式,一个2-of-3多签钱包,意味着需要3个签名者中的任意2个签名才能发起交易,常用于团队资产管理、交易所冷热钱包、企业资金管理等。
  • 去中心化自治组织(DAO)的治理:DAO的重要决策或资金使用,可以通过双签或多签机制来确保决策的民主性和资金的安全性,防止“独裁者”的出现。
  • 跨链桥与原子交换:在跨链资产转移或原子交换中,双签可以确保资产在源链和目标链之间的同步转移,避免重放攻击或单方违约风险。
  • 智能合约的升级与关键操作:对于一些关键的智能合约,其升级或执行某些高危操作时,可以引入双签机制,需要合约所有者(或指定管理员)和另一个授权方的共同确认,防止恶意升级或误操作。
  • 供应链金融与贸易结算:在涉及多方参与的供应链交易中,双签可以确保订单、发货、收款等关键环节的真实性和不可抵赖性,提高交易效率,降低信任成本。

双签应用的挑战与展望

尽管双签应用前景广阔,但也面临一些挑战:

  • 密钥管理复杂性:多个私钥的管理、备份和恢复相对复杂,一旦某个私钥丢失,可能会影响整体使用(如3-of-3钱包,丢失一个则无法达到签名阈值)。
  • 用户体验与效率:相较于单签,双签可能需要协调多方,增加交易确认的时间和复杂度,对用户体验有一定影响。
  • 标准与兼容性:目前双签在不同平台和协议间的实现标准尚未完全统一,可能存在兼容性问题。

展望未来,随着区块链技术的不断成熟和应用场景的深入拓展,双签机制有望进一步优化,通过 threshold signature(门限签名)等密码学技术的改进,可以简化密钥管理流程;结合零知识证明等技术,可以在保护隐私的前提下实现高效的双签验证。

区块链双签应用,本质上是通过引入第二重签名验证机制,在去中心化的网络环境中构建起一道额外的安全防线,实现多方对资产或操作的共同控制与信任,它不仅显著提升了区块链系统的安全性和抗攻击能力,也为组织协作、合规管理、跨链交互等复杂场景提供了可行的技术方案,随着技术的演进和生态的完善,双签必将在推动区块链技术从“可用”向“好用”和“放心用”的转变过程中扮演越来越重要的角色。

本文由用户投稿上传,若侵权请提供版权资料并联系删除!